I am in the proccess of air sealing and adding insulation to my attic and had a questiorn. The attic is unfinished with baffles in the rafters and fiberglass batts. The baffles aren't very long and I want to add more batts on top of the exisiting ones.

If i install long baffles in the rafters can I install the batts right up to the baffles as long as the batts dont fall down into the soffet and the baffles stick above the batts?
